Noun [Sanskrit]

IPA: /ʋɑː.ɳɐ́/ [Vedic], /ˈʋɑː.ɳɐ/ [Classical]
Etymology: Of unclear origin. Müller connects the word to Proto-Iranian *vāna-ka-, reflected in Persian بانگ (bâng, “voice, noise”). However, the Persian term is likely derived from Proto-Indo-European *wṓkʷs (“voice, speech”), whence वाच् (vāc, “speech”), while वाण (vāṇa) is not easily derivable from that root. Turner's attempt to link the word to Proto-Indo-European *werh₁- (“to speak, say”) is formally unconvincing. Mayrhofer also rejects connections to वण् (vaṇ, “to sound”) and leaves the origin of the latter open. Alternatively, Kuiper takes the word as a Munda borrowing. Whether or not the "arrow" meaning is a semantic extension of the "noise" meaning or a phonetic variant of बाण (bāṇa, “arrow”) is uncertain.
